Oh, and to answer your question that you posted on Tumblr, record labels set aside a TON of tickets to give to radio station staff, record stores, and other random people they want to schmooze with (like sometimes local companies have box seats that they save for their higher ups) and fan clubs buy a chunk too. Any they don't plan to use they slowly give back, so sometimes you can find awesome seats on the night of the show. [livejournal.com profile] sideflip did this the first time I met her, at a Pearl Jam show, she got front row seats by buying tickets at the door. Madness.
